Is 690 145 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 690 145 is about 830.750.

Thus, the square root of 690 145 is not an integer, and therefore 690 145 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 690 145?

The square of a number (here 690 145) is the result of the product of this number (690 145) by itself (i.e., 690 145 × 690 145); the square of 690 145 is sometimes called "raising 690 145 to the power 2", or "690 145 squared".

The square of 690 145 is 476 300 121 025 because 690 145 × 690 145 = 690 1452 = 476 300 121 025.

As a consequence, 690 145 is the square root of 476 300 121 025.
